Career Summary
Wraps up one of the most storied four-year careers in program history, finishing with a 28-10 record and 3.20 ERA ... His 330 all-time strikeouts are a program record, breaking John Hendricks' previous record (312) set in 1999 ... Also ranks in the top 10 all-time in innings pitched (third - 326.1), wins (fourth - 28), and strikeouts per nine innings (sixth - 9.10) ... Became just the second Deacon to post two 100-strikeout seasons, joining first-round pick Kyle Sleeth (2002-03). 2017 (Senior)
Finished the season with a 9-1 record and 3.91 ERA as Wake Forest's Friday starter for the second-straight season ... Struck out 111 batters, a mark that ranks tied for fourth in program history ... Left the game in line for the win in 15 straight outings from Feb. 24-June 3, going undefeated after his Feb. 17 loss at Houston ... Shut down national powers Miami (March 31) and Louisville (Apr. 7) on back-to-back weekends, going 7.0 innings and allowing just one run each game, striking out nine Hurricanes and six Cardinals as the Deacs won both games ... Struck out 12 in back-to-back outings against Duke (March 17) and Georgia Tech (March 24) ... In an extra-inning Super Regional loss at Florida, came back out after a three-hour rain delay in the fourth inning and finished 8.0 innings, allowing one run on three hits with eight strikeouts ... Wins came over USC, Kent State, NC State, Duke, Miami, Louisville, Notre Dame, Boston College and Pittsburgh. 2016 (Junior)
As Wake Forest's Friday starter, finished the year with a 10-5 record and 3.20 ERA, striking out 102 batters in 101.1 innings ... Struck out 10+ batters three times and fanned 8+ seven times ... After starting the year with a 4-3 mark in his first seven starts, went 6-2 to close the year ... Became the first Deacon to strike out 100+ batters in a season since 2002, and ranks tied for seventh in the program's history with 102 ... Completed seven or more innings of work in more than half of his starts ... Didn't allow a run or walk in 6.0 innings in season-opening win over Georgetown (Feb. 19) ... Struck out a career-high 12 with only one walk in victory over Towson (March 4) ... Tossed 6.0 shutout frames against Duke (March 25) ... Shut down top-25 foes on back-to-back weekends, combining to allow one run in 15.0 innings against Florida State (Apr. 15) and North Carolina (Apr. 22) ... Struck out 10 in 6.2 innings to beat Duke in ACC Tournament opening round game ... Pushed the Deacs to an NCAA Regional opener victory over Minnesota with 11 strikeouts in 7.2 innings of two-run ball ... also earned wins over Clemson, Boston College and Virginia Tech. 2015 (Sophomore)
Did it all for the Wake Forest pitching staff, splitting time between starting, closing, and long relief ... Led the Demon Deacon pitching staff with a 2.89 ERA and four saves to go along with a 5-3 record ... Started the year 5-0 with a 1.80 ERA into April ... Shut down VCU in his first start (Feb. 14), striking out 11 in 8.1 shutout innings ... Didn't give up an earned run in his first three starts (20.1 innings), striking out 28 batters as he went 3-0 in that span ... Picked up a 3.1-inning save at Florida State (March 13), allowing two hits and striking out seven ... Tossed 6.2 innings in relief as he picked up a win over Miami (March 22), allowing just one run ... Also earned saves against Clemson, Notre Dame and Duke and a win over Boston College ... Struck out 74 batters in 71.2 innings while allowing just 58 hits ... Likely to enter 2016 with the best career ERA of anyone in the ACC with at least 100 innings pitched ... Played summer ball with the Chatham Anglers in the Cape Cod League, finishing with a 4-2 record and 1.79 ERA, including playoffs and the all-star game. 2014 (Freshman)
Emerged as an impactful reliever in late situations ... Finished the season with a 2.17 ERA and a 4-1 record ... His ERA is the second best earned run average by a freshman in Wake Forest history ... His 27 appearances is also tied for second most by a freshman in school history ... Recorded one save and pitched 49.2 innings ... Gave up just 18 runs and 12 earned runs ... Struck out 43 while limiting opponents to a batting average of .221 ... Made his collegiate debut against Marshall (Feb. 17) and struck out three in three scoreless innings while not giving up a hit ... Did not give up a run in his first four appearances ... Picked up his first collegiate win against High Point (April 2) while earning his second win against Appalachian State (April 16) ... Also earned the victory over Charlotte (April 22) and Virginia (May 16) ... Went three innings and did not five up a hit in the win over NC State (May 12) ... Struck out the last batter against Virginia (May 17) to seal the series win over the top-ranked team in the nation ... Playing for the Wisconsin Woodchucks in the Northwoods League during the summer. High School
Has earned seven varsity letters to date, including three in football, two in baseball and two in basketball ... Was an All-Conference quarterback and earned Academic All-State honors as a senior ... Holds seven passing records at Zionsville Community H.S. ... Two-time All-Conference selection in baseball ... Named ZCHS Varsity Pitcher of the Year as a junior ... Selected as member of Indianapolis Star's SuperTeam and to the All-Metro North Team.
